Nigerian solar: Developers, DFIs and delays

Nigeria’s plan to finance 14 utility-scale solar IPP projects by the end of June 2018 is looking uncertain. Potential DFI appetite is waning as state-owned offtaker Nigerian Bulk Electricity Trading attempts to renegotiate tariffs on the 20-year offtake agreements it signed in 2016.
